2011 BDT to NAD Performance & Market Timing Review

Analysis of key historical highlights and timing insights for 2011

During 2011, the BDT to NAD exchange rate experienced significant fluctuation. The market reached its absolute peak on November 23, valuing the pair at 0.1112. Conversely, the yearly low was recorded on July 27, dropping to 0.0888.

This high-to-low spread represents a total annual volatility of 0.0224 NAD. From a start-to-finish perspective, comparing the January average rate of 0.0976 to the December average rate of 0.1045, the exchange rate registered a net change of 7.07% (reflecting a strengthening trend).

Looking at year-over-year peak valuations, the 2011 high of 0.1112 was down 0.90% compared to the 2010 peak of 0.1122, indicating shifts in long-term support levels.

Seasonal Halves (H1 vs H2)

Seasonal

The average exchange rate in the first half of the year (H1: Jan–Jun) was 0.0954, compared to 0.1004 in the second half (H2: Jul–Dec). This shows that the rate was stronger in the second half (Jul–Dec) by a margin of 0.0050 points.

Volatility Range Comparison

Volatility

The most volatile month in 2011 was September, with a trading range of 0.0119 NAD (High: 0.1068 / Low: 0.0949). On the other end, June was the most stable month, with a tight range of 0.0021 NAD (High: 0.0931 / Low: 0.0911).

Growth Streaks & Declines

Trends

Between July and November, the exchange rate recorded its longest consecutive growth streak of the year, climbing for 4 straight months. Conversely, the sharpest month-over-month decline occurred between February and March, when the average rate fell by 0.0051 points.

Monthly Breakdown

Statistical summary for each calendar month.

Month High Low Average
January 0.1015 0.0936 0.0976
February 0.1031 0.0979 0.1011
March 0.0982 0.0936 0.0960
April 0.0941 0.0904 0.0923
May 0.0961 0.0902 0.0937
June 0.0931 0.0911 0.0919
July 0.0936 0.0888 0.0910
August 0.0981 0.0897 0.0952
September 0.1068 0.0949 0.0999
October 0.1073 0.1034 0.1053
November 0.1112 0.1036 0.1066
December 0.1091 0.0989 0.1045
